# Superpipes

This is a [Yahoo! Pipes](http://pipes.yahoo.com/pipes/) equivalent built with [Superfeedr](http://superfeedr.com/), hosted on [Heroku](http://www.heroku.com/). We built that just in case Y! decides to "sunset" pipes as well...

Here is what it does:

* Agregate feeds
* Displays the agregate (Atom, Json or HTML)

Also, it's realtime, and can be tweaked in any way you want to fit your needs!
